Plastic grocery bags do not deteriorate in our landfills, so the more ways we can find to reuse them the better. The normal ways of reusing them such as suitcases,wet bathing suit bags, etc. are all good, but this is a very unique way to create small wreaths that will last forever. Use them as gift tags,package decorations,or ornaments.
The brown plastic ones look just like straw when they are braided.

Difficulty: Moderately Easy
Instructions

Things You'll Need:

  • plastic grocery bags
  • assorted beads,etc.
  • craft paint
  1. Step 1
    Beginning Braided Strip
     
    Beginning Braided Strip

    Choose 3 bags and one to cut pieces from for ties. Grasp the bags upside down in the center of the bottom. Put the ends together and clamp it so they won't come loose while you're braiding.
    I use binder clips, but even a large paper clip will do.

  2. Step 2
    Finished Braid Strip
     
    Finished Braid Strip

    Make a braid, leaving about 2-3 inches loose on each end.
    Use small pieces of the fourth bag to tie the ends with.

  3. Step 3
    Crossed over Ends
     
    Crossed over Ends

    After braiding put the two ends together crossing them over. Tie it firmly in the center. This will create the bow.

  4. Step 4
    Additional Unique Wreaths
     
    Additional Unique Wreaths

    Use scissors to trim the excess ends evenly so it looks like a bow.
    Then add any decoration you desire.
    When the wreath is painted green, the pattern of the folded plastic makes it really look like greenery.

Tips & Warnings
  • Any stray pieces of plastic should be snipped before painting.
  • Use ribbon or an ornament hanger to attach them to packages or Christmas trees.
